Around a week after his unfortunate demise on 12th January 2005, he was seen last in Kisna. After that the veteran actor was not seen in any other film. Around 20 months after his death, he was be seen on the big screen again in Kachchi Sadak, a film by Sanjay D Singh. Kachchi Sadak stars Rahul Singh, Parmita Katkar and Madhoo along with host of character artists like Mukesh Tiwari, Rahul Dev, Aman Verma, Govind Namdeo, Sharat Saxena, Tinu Anand and Anant Jog.
An added attraction about the film was a special appearance by Mithun Chakraborty. Made under the banner of Jia Entertainment Network Pvt. Ltd.,
Amrish Puri plays a jailor who deals with the main criminals inside and outside the jail. The film revolves around the life of liquor barons of North India. The feud in the family as well as with the politicians forms the main plot of the film. Also, the movie throws light on the wrong influence of liquor on the youth.
